Transaction 80de2080be6abf58b4fdd895fb24427bb8009ff2891a88f36a15db86d5d098e9
1 Input
1 Output
-
80de2080be6abf58b4fdd895fb24427bb8009ff2891a88f36a15db86d5d098e9:0
- value
- 99992
- script pubkey
- OP_0 OP_PUSHBYTES_32 337476b0dd3c09a630656770468e5b28fa57c00dc2e9756b2eff0c6520aa1f0d
- address
- bc1qxd68dvxa8sy6vvr9vacydrjm9ra90sqdct5h26ewluxx2g92ruxs8z0drj